TEACHER'S MANUAL for The Complete Advocate: A Practice File for Representing Clients from Beginning to End

The Complete Advocate: A Practice File for Representing Clients from Beginning to End can be thought of as a start–to–finish approach to representing a client – a realistic way for a student to be oriented into the administration of a case from the preliminary stages until the very end. The book is applicable to many contexts and provides professors with a variety of options in designing their curricula.

The book is ideal for skills courses – first–year writing and research and advocacy, trial and appellate advocacy, drafting, interviewing, negotiation and settlement – as well as for trial and appellate advocacy competitions – as all of the necessary materials and answers are provided.
